AI Technical Summary

Technical Problem

In existing technologies, the distance between the spray gun and the spring mattress is fixed, which cannot adapt to mattresses of different sizes, resulting in unstable bonding quality between the sponge strip and the spring mattress.

Method used

A spray adhesive assembly for bonding sponge to spring mattress mesh was designed. It adopts a gantry structure with two glue gun nozzles facing forward and backward respectively. The glue guns are moved left and right by a power component. Combined with the forward and backward sliding of the gantry, the relative distance between the glue guns and the sponge and spring mattress mesh is adjusted. With the help of the lifting component, a wave-shaped glue spraying is achieved.

Benefits of technology

It improves the bonding strength and stability of sponge and spring mattress, adapts to the adhesive spraying requirements of mattresses of different sizes, and ensures bonding quality.

Abstract

The utility model provides a glue spraying assembly for adhering sponge to a spring bed net, and belongs to the technical field of machinery. The glue spraying mechanism solves the problem that an existing glue spraying mechanism is poor in adaptability. The glue spraying assembly comprises a base and a portal frame, a glue spraying assembly and a power assembly used for driving the glue spraying assembly to slide left and right are arranged on the portal frame, the glue spraying assembly comprises a glue gun, the left end and the right end of the portal frame are slidably arranged on the base, and the portal frame is driven by a driving assembly to slide front and back; the number of the glue guns is two, and injection orifices of the two glue guns are arranged forwards and backwards respectively. The glue spraying assembly for adhering the sponge to the spring bed net is good in adaptability.

TECHNICAL FIELD

[0001] The utility model belongs to mechanical technical field relates to a glue spraying assembly, especially a glue spraying assembly for spring bed net and sponge sticking. BACKGROUND

[0002] In the production of the mattress, in order to ensure that the four sides of the mattress have strong supporting force and do not slip, and at the same time ensure that the appearance of the side of the mattress is flat and the user cannot touch the spring, the industry practitioners generally use a sponge strip with high hardness to be fixed on the four sides of the spring bed net with glue to strengthen the support of the four sides.

[0003] At present, the sponge strip is generally bonded by using automatic equipment, and the structure of the equipment is disclosed in a spring bed net sponge strip bonding device (application number: 202410133040.7) in the Chinese patent library, which comprises a rack and straight line guides A vertically arranged on both sides of the front end of the rack, the rack is sequentially provided with a bed net rotating mechanism, a bed net feeding mechanism and a sponge strip feeding mechanism from top to bottom; the front end of the bed net feeding mechanism is provided with a lower cloth folding assembly and an upper cloth folding assembly, the lower cloth folding assembly comprises a lower cloth folding fixed plate and a lower cloth folding movable plate, the rear end of the lower cloth folding fixed plate is connected with the bed net feeding mechanism, the lower cloth folding movable plate is vertically arranged on the front end of the lower cloth folding fixed plate through a cylinder, the front end of the lower cloth folding fixed plate is also provided with an inclined downward bending section, the upper cloth folding assembly comprises a mounting profile, an upper cloth folding fixed plate and an upper cloth folding movable plate, the two sides of the mounting profile are vertically arranged on the front end of the straight line guide A through a sliding block, the sliding block is connected with a mounting profile lifting motor through a nut seat and a screw rod transmission, the upper cloth folding fixed plate and the upper cloth folding movable plate are vertically arranged on the rear end of the mounting profile through a cylinder respectively, the upper cloth folding fixed plate is vertically arranged above the lower cloth folding fixed plate, the upper cloth folding movable plate is vertically arranged above the lower cloth folding movable plate, the front end of the upper cloth folding fixed plate is provided with an inclined upward bending section; the front end of the mounting profile is provided with a movable spray gun through a sliding rail sliding block, the spray gun is connected with a spray gun moving motor through a belt clamp and a belt transmission, four to six groups of nozzles are vertically arranged on the spray gun, wherein the two outermost groups of nozzles are respectively aligned with the bending sections of the lower cloth folding fixed plate and the upper cloth folding fixed plate.

[0004] In the above-mentioned device, the distance between the spray gun and the spring bed net is fixed and cannot be adjusted, but there are various sizes of spring bed nets, which makes it difficult for the spray gun to adapt to various sizes of spring bed nets, and it is easy to affect the bonding quality of the sponge strip and the spring bed net. UTILITY MODEL CONTENTS

[0005] The utility model aims at the above-mentioned problems existing in the prior art, and provides a glue spraying assembly for spring bed net and sponge sticking, which solves the technical problem of how to ensure that different sizes of bed nets and sponges can be stably bonded.

[0006] The utility model discloses a spring bed net sticks to the glue spraying assembly for sponge, including base and gantry, be equipped with glue spraying subassembly and be used for driving glue spraying subassembly left and right slide power component on the gantry, and glue spraying subassembly includes glue gun, its characterized in that, the left and right two ends of gantry are slidably arranged on the base, and are driven by drive assembly and make the gantry slide forwards and backwards, and the spray port of two glue guns is respectively set to face forward and backward.

[0007] When actually using, the sponge and the spring bed net are arranged on the front side and the back side of the gantry respectively, the two glue guns are aimed at the sponge and the spring bed net respectively, and the glue gun assembly is moved left and right under the action of the power component to perform glue spraying operation.

[0008] The spray ports of the two glue guns are set to face forward and backward respectively, so that the bonding surfaces of the sponge and the spring bed net can be covered with glue, thereby improving the bonding strength and stability of the sponge and the spring bed net.

[0009] Secondly, the gantry can slide forwards and backwards, and can be used to adjust the relative distance between the glue gun and the sponge and the spring bed net, so that the sponge and the spring bed net of different sizes can be better glued, and the bonding strength and stability of the sponge and the spring bed net are further improved.

[0010] In the glue spraying assembly for the spring bed net sticking to the sponge, the power component includes a sliding frame and a translation component for driving the sliding frame to translate left and right, and the glue spraying component is arranged on the sliding frame. By adopting the above design, the glue spraying component is convenient to install and position, and has the advantages of simple structure, stable work and the like.

[0011] In the glue spraying assembly for the spring bed net sticking to the sponge, the sliding frame is further provided with a bracket and a lifting component for driving the bracket to lift, and the above-mentioned glue spraying component is arranged on the bracket. Under the cooperation of the lifting component and the bracket, the glue spraying component can move up and down to realize wave-shaped glue spraying and other functions, thereby increasing the glue coverage area and making the bonding of the sponge and the spring bed net more stable.

[0012] In the glue spraying assembly for the spring bed net sticking to the sponge, two straight linear guides are horizontally fixed on the base and extend in length forwards and backwards; sliding blocks are installed on the two straight linear guides, and the left and right ends of the gantry are respectively fixed to the two sliding blocks. The gantry is slidably supported on the base through the guide sliding block structure, and has the advantages of simple structure, stable sliding and the like.

[0013] In the glue spraying assembly for the spring bed net sticking to the sponge, the types of the translation component and the lifting component are both linear modules, and have the advantages of simple structure, stable work and the like.

[0014] In the glue spraying assembly for the spring bed net sticking to the sponge, the drive component includes a motor, and the motor is connected with the gantry through a screw nut structure.

[0022] As shown in Figure 1 , the spring bed net and sponge spraying assembly comprises a base 1 and a gantry 2.

[0023] Specifically,

[0024] As shown in Figure 1 and Figure 2 , the left and right ends of the gantry 2 are slidingly arranged on the base 1 and driven by a driving assembly to slide forward and backward. The gantry 2 is provided with a glue spraying assembly 3 and a power assembly for driving the glue spraying assembly 3 to slide left and right. The specific structure of the glue spraying assembly 3 is the prior art, which is not described here. The glue spraying assembly 3 comprises a glue gun 3a, and the glue gun 3a has two, and the spraying openings of the two glue guns 3a are respectively arranged forward and backward.

[0025] In actual use, the sponge and the spring bed net are respectively arranged on the front side and the rear side of the gantry 2, and the two glue guns 3a are respectively aligned with the sponge and the spring bed net, and the glue gun 3a assembly moves left and right under the action of the power assembly to perform glue spraying operation.

[0026] The spray openings of the two glue guns 3a are arranged forward and backward respectively, so that the bonding surfaces of the sponge and the spring bed net can be covered with glue, thereby improving the bonding strength and stability of the sponge and the spring bed net.

[0027] Secondly, the gantry 2 can slide forward and backward, and can be used to adjust the relative distance between the glue gun 3a and the sponge and the spring bed net, so that the sponge and the spring bed net of different sizes can be better glued, thereby further improving the bonding strength and stability of the sponge and the spring bed net.

[0028] In the embodiment,

[0029] The gantry 2 is installed as follows: two linear guides 4 are horizontally fixed on the base 1 and extend in length forward and backward. The two linear guides 4 are both provided with sliding blocks, and the two sliding blocks are fixedly connected to the left and right ends of the gantry 2. The gantry 2 is supported on the base 1 through the guide sliding block structure, and has the advantages of simple structure and stable sliding. Naturally, the gantry 2 can also be connected to the base 1 through the sliding groove guide block structure.

[0030] The driving assembly includes a motor 5, and the motor 5 is connected to one end of the gantry 2 through a screw nut structure. Naturally, the driving assembly can also be a pneumatic cylinder, and in this case, the piston rod of the pneumatic cylinder is fixedly connected to one end of the gantry 2.

[0031] As shown in the figure, Figure 2 The power assembly includes a sliding carriage 6 and a translation assembly 7 for driving the sliding carriage 6 to translate left and right, and the glue spraying assembly 3 is arranged on the sliding carriage 6. With the above design, the glue spraying assembly 3 is convenient to install and position, and has the advantages of simple structure and stable work. Further, the sliding carriage 6 is also provided with a bracket 8 and a lifting assembly 9 for driving the bracket 8 to lift, and the above-mentioned glue spraying assembly 3 is arranged on the bracket 8. Under the cooperation of the lifting assembly 9 and the bracket 8, the glue spraying assembly 3 can move up and down, realize wave-shaped glue spraying and other functions, increase the glue coverage area, and make the bonding of the sponge and the spring bed net more stable.

[0032] In actual products, the types of the translation assembly 7 and the lifting assembly 9 are both linear modules, which have the advantages of simple structure and stable work. Naturally, the translation assembly 7 can also be a motor screw nut transmission structure, in which case the sliding carriage 6 is connected to the gantry 2 in a sliding manner; and the lifting assembly 9 can also be a pneumatic cylinder.
